What does Alexiana mean and where does it come from?
Alexiana is a modern and feminine derivative of the masculine name Alexander, which has Greek origins (Ἀλέξανδρος). The meaning 'defender of mankind' is attributed to Alexander. Alexiana may have gained popularity in the late 20th century as names with 'Alex-' prefixes became fashionable, alongside

The story of Alexiana
Alexiana is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 1995. With 452 total births recorded, Alexiana remains relatively uncommon. Once ranked #10464 in 1995, the name has become less common in recent years, sitting at #11223 in 2023.
